**Research Key Ingredients**
Most joint supplements contain a variety of ingredients that are believed to support joint health. Common ingredients to look for include:
1. **Glucosamine:** Often derived from shellfish, glucosamine is known for its potential to promote cartilage health and alleviate joint pain. It is particularly popular among those suffering from osteoarthritis.
2. **Chondroitin:** Frequently combined with glucosamine, chondroitin may help retain cartilage’s elasticity and provide cushioning for joints.
3. **MSM (Methylsulfonylmethane):** This organic sulfur compound is believed to reduce inflammation and improve flexibility, making it a valuable addition to any joint health regimen.
4. **Turmeric:** Known for its anti-inflammatory properties thanks to the compound curcumin, turmeric may help reduce joint pain and stiffness.
5. **Hyaluronic Acid:** Naturally occurring in the body, hyaluronic acid is essential for maintaining joint lubrication and cushioning, which can be particularly beneficial for active individuals.
When researching potential supplements, be sure to read product labels carefully and look for a combination of these ingredients to support your knee health effectively.

**Check for Quality and Purity**
Quality matters immensely when it comes to dietary supplements. Look for brands that are transparent about their manufacturing processes and ingredient sourcing. Third-party testing is a good indicator of a high-quality product, as it ensures the supplement contains what it claims and is free from harmful contaminants. Research customer reviews and testimonials to gauge the effectiveness and reliability of various brands.

**Trial and Patience**
Once you have selected a joint supplement, be patient and give it time to work. Many joint supplements may take several weeks or even months to show noticeable results. Keep track of your symptoms and any changes you experience. If after a reasonable period you notice improvements in knee stiffness and flexibility, you may have found your ideal joint support solution.
